YouTube wants to prove to its biggest stars that the popular video service is more than just an advertising business.

The Google-owned company is paying talent to use and promote new features, including paid memberships and an enhanced chat.

According to Bloomberg, the amounts range from $10,000 – $100,000. Youtube stars will be paid for enabling revenue-driving features including paid Memberships – which cost $4.99 per month for fans and first launched last year as Sponsorships – as well as Super Chat, which lets fans pay to make their messages more apparent in the lightning-fast clutter of a live stream chat.

The aforementioned features are meant to entice creators to stay on YouTube. Memberships are only available to creators with more than 100,000 subscribers.
